Unlike high technology lasers and surgical procedures, microdermabrasion offers facial rejuvenation minus the invasive process. It remains quite effective in removing fine lines and wrinkles and treating acne scars, sun damage and freckles. This is why more and more people are becoming interested in this skin care procedure - it can very well give us soft and smooth skin without the pain and the worry of having to go through an invasive procedure.

However, it is also important to note that not every one of us can undergo this kind of process. There are some people who cannot just go into microdermabrasion. These are those who are prone to excessive scarring, like raised red keloid scars. Also, if you are prone to form discolored spots due to skin injuries, you might want to reconsider going through this skin care procedure. Also, do not jump into dermabrasion if you have warts, undiagnosed skin lesions, active acne or rosacea, autoimmune diseases like lupus, uncontrolled diabetes and pigment disorders.
